Ndubuisi Obi Listenⓘ is an Anglican bishop in Nigeria:[1] since 2019 he has been the Bishop of Nnewi.[2]
He was elected Bishop of Nnewi to succeed Godwin Okpala on 23 August 2019 at St. Peter's Chapel, Ibru International Ecumenical Centre, Agbarha Otor, Delta State.[3]
